For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 195 students in the neighborhood of East Somerville, Somerville, MA.
The neighborhood of East Somerville, Somerville, MA public preschools have a diversity score of 0.71, which is more than the Massachusetts public preschool average of 0.68.
Minority enrollment is 57%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Massachusetts public preschool average of 53% (majority Hispanic).
